AT last, a Cork football championship game to savour, with pace, smashing points and wholehearted commitment as Killavullen earned a replay with Nemo Rangers in their Premier IFC third round clash at Rathcormac.

Nemo will bemoan missing an early penalty and two gilt edged goal chances, while they also had midfielder Liam O’Sullivan sent off. Killavullen deserved their draw, however, with young Joe O’Neill always a thorn in the Nemo defence.

Nemo hit the ground running, and, after only 30 seconds, Padraig O’Shea put them in front. Three minutes later, Nemo’s Michael Kearney put Joe Kavanagh through, and, when he was upended, O’Sullivan cannoned his penalty effort off the crossbar.
